Congratulations to Christopher Yen, July Tutor of the Month!
Christopher’s student has come a long way since they started working together in the fall of 2024. Because Alejo is a guitarist, he wants to be able to introduce his songs in English, so they’ve been focusing on pronunciation and idioms. Alejo also got a job as a crossing guard, so lessons focus on English small talk with students and parents. Most recently he was offered a full-time music teaching position, complete with benefits!
Learn More About Christopher:
LVSC Journey: My first tutoring session with Alejo began in October 2024 at the Bernardsville Public Library.
What motivated you to become an LVSC volunteer? As a retiree, I wanted to spend some of my free time giving back to the community. LVSC was the perfect place to offer my services.
Proud Moment: One of my proudest moments was completing the training program and earning my LVSC certificate, officially designating me as an LVSC ESL tutor. Also, Alejo’s ongoing improvement in English pronunciation inspires me every time we meet.
Day Job: I volunteer at The Food Bank Network of Somerset County (located in Bridgewater), putting in about 20-30 hours per week. Tasks include driving the van for donation pickups, sorting and general warehouse assignments. I also serve on the Food Bank’s board.
